its been a long wait for australia. 32 years after their last and only appearance, also in germany. Coach hiddinks abilities as a coach are essential to australia progressing to the knockout stage.

They are weak in defence with a back line that is slow and sometimes clumsy. The aim will be to pressure the opposition further up the park. They will look to win their first game again japan and its a fairly easy start. However, the speed of the japanese could give the back line some trouble, but australias superior firepower should mean a winning start.

Qualification could come down to their meeting with croatia, a hard game with a closely matched team - but one australia is more than capable of winning!
